Xylem's Guidance Boost Driven by Buybacks, Bolt-On Acquisition, RBC Says

Xylem (XYL) raised its full-year profit outlook after posting a second-quarter operating beat, as strength in municipal water demand and industrial markets offset delays in electric meter deployments, RBC Capital Markets said in a note Tuesday.

The company also deployed capital toward growth, closing a roughly $200 million deal for WaterFleet, a mobile water treatment business tied to AI-related end markets such as data centers, semiconductors and power generation, and repurchasing about $648 million of shares in the quarter, according to the note.

The bank said Xylem's Water Solutions and Services unit also booked a large outsourced water contract with a major chemical company, marking its second big such win in as many quarters.

RBC rates the stock Outperform and raised the price target to $164 from $159.
